The increasing demand for ethical alternatives to animal testing, growing pharmaceutical and cosmetic research, and rising adoption of advanced tissue engineering technologies are driving the growth of the human skin model market. However, the market also faces several challenges. High development and production costs, complex manufacturing processes, and the need for standardized validation protocols can limit widespread adoption. In addition, regulatory compliance, limited scalability of advanced 3D skin models, and the requirement for highly specialized research expertise continue to create operational challenges for manufacturers and research organizations.

Despite these challenges, according to Wise Guy Reports, the Human Skin Model Market is expected to witness steady growth as industries increasingly shift toward human-relevant in vitro testing methods. The market was valued at USD 800 million in 2024 and is projected to grow from USD 800 million in 2025 to USD 1.5 billion by 2035, registering a CAGR of 5.9% during the forecast period. Growing adoption of 3D bioprinting, reconstructed skin models, organ-on-chip technologies, and advanced toxicology testing platforms is creating significant opportunities for market expansion. Increasing regulatory support for non-animal testing methods and expanding applications in wound healing, dermatology research, and personalized medicine are expected to further support long-term market growth.
